Women’s Tennis Earns ITA Community Award Honorable Mention

6/9/2023 10:55:00 AM | Women's Tennis

PHOENIX – The Boise State women's tennis program has been named the 2023 Intercollegiate Tennis Association's (ITA) Community Service Award Honorable Mention for the Mountain Region. The Broncos were selected from a pool of 21 programs which included teams from the Big Sky, Conference USA, Mountain West, Pac-12, Summit League, West Coast Conference and Western Atlantic Conference.
 
"We're proud and honored to be able to serve Boise State and the Boise community," head coach Beck Roghaar said. "Serving others is such a key part of success in life and having the opportunity to do that with the people that support us and the university so much is amazing. We're just so incredibly proud."
 
The team recorded 119 hours of community service throughout the Boise community last year. The Broncos served many local organizations, including the Boise State Food Pantry, Idaho Arts Charter, Make-A-Wish, Rake up Boise, Owyhee High School, Whittier Elementary School and undertook several projects in the Boise State athletic department.
 
Every year the ITA recognizes coaches and players for their excellence on the court and in their
communities throughout the season. This is the third time in the last four years in which the Boise State women's tennis program has been honored by the ITA for community service. The Broncos won the award in back-to-back years in 2020 and 2021.
 
"We're incredibly blessed and fortunate to be in the community that we are in here at Boise State," Roghaar said. "The support around us and the people around our program and in this community, they're a key ingredient to what this whole experience and opportunity is all about for our student-athletes."
